Spicy Fried Chicken Bowl with Bang Bang Sauce Recipe
Introduction
This Chicken Bowl combines crispy fried chicken with fresh vegetables and a spicy, creamy bang bang sauce for a satisfying meal. It’s easy to prepare and perfect for a quick lunch or dinner that feels both comforting and exciting.

Ingredients
- 1 lb chicken breast cut into bite-sized pieces
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 2 eggs beaten
- 1 cup panko breadcrumbs
- 1/2 cup mayonnaise
- 1/4 cup sweet chili sauce
- 2 tbsp sriracha sauce
- 2 cups cooked rice
- 1 cup shredded lettuce
- 1/2 cup sliced cucumbers
- 1/2 cup shredded carrots
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Oil for frying
Instructions
- Step 1: Season the chicken pieces with salt and pepper evenly.
- Step 2: Dredge each chicken piece in flour, then dip into the beaten eggs, and finally coat thoroughly with panko breadcrumbs.
- Step 3: Heat oil in a frying pan over medium heat. Fry the chicken pieces until they are golden brown and fully cooked through, about 4-5 minutes per side depending on size.
- Step 4: In a small bowl, combine mayonnaise, sweet chili sauce, and sriracha sauce to create the bang bang sauce. Stir until smooth.
- Step 5: In serving bowls, start with a base of cooked rice, then layer shredded lettuce, sliced cucumbers, and shredded carrots on top.
- Step 6: Place the fried chicken pieces over the vegetables and drizzle generously with bang bang sauce.
- Step 7: Serve immediately while the chicken is crispy and enjoy your flavorful bowl!
Tips & Variations
- For extra crunch, double coat the chicken by repeating the egg and breadcrumb step before frying.
- Swap out sweet chili sauce for honey or BBQ sauce for a different twist on the bang bang sauce.
- Add avocado slices or pickled radish for additional freshness and texture.
- Use brown rice or quinoa as a healthier grain option.
Storage
Store leftover fried chicken and sauce separately in airtight containers in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at the chicken in an oven or air fryer to maintain crispiness before assembling the bowl again. The fresh vegetables are best added just before serving to keep them crisp.

FAQs
Can I bake the chicken instead of frying?
Yes, you can bake the breaded chicken pieces at 400°F (200°C) for about 20 minutes, flipping halfway through, until golden and cooked through. This is a healthier alternative but may be less crispy.
Is this recipe spicy?
The bang bang sauce has a moderate level of heat from the sriracha, but you can reduce or omit it depending on your spice preference. Sweet chili sauce adds sweetness to balance the spice.
